An ideal picture book for children with separation anxiety. Arthur is spending his first day apart from his mother, but his grandmother knows just what to do. This warm, funny story by the award-winning Tracey Corderoy (HUBBLE BUBBLE, GRANNY TROUBLE, THE GRUNT AND THE GROUCH) is perfect for reassuring toddlers worried about being away from their parents, whether that's starting nursery or being left with grandparents. With warm, bright illustrations by the award-winning Alison Edgson (YUCK! THAT'S NOT A MONSTER!), this simple story is just right for parents to share with preschoolers who are experiencing separation anxiety.

Biography/History:
Tracey was born in South Wales and now lives in Gloucestershire with her husband, two daughters and a menagerie of animals. She is a trained teacher and used to run specialist literacy programmes in schools before becoming a full-time writer.
